Checklist
- Request batch photographs and a packing list prior to shipment.
- Verify that artwork matches the approved compliance template.
- Check carton quantities against the commercial invoice line by line.
- Retain one sealed sample carton from every batch for reference.
- Record the arrival condition with photographs on the day of delivery.
- Keep certificates current and filed against the exact model name.

Frequently asked questions
Who handles Marvos GT customs clearance?
Usually the importer's broker; the supplier provides the commercial documents and certificates needed.
Can packaging be adjusted for our market?
Artwork localisation is straightforward; structural changes need larger volumes and a longer lead time.
Can several models be mixed in one shipment?
Yes, mixing models and flavours within a carton or pallet is common and usually helps first time buyers test demand.
Is documentation provided for customs?
Commercial invoice, packing list and the relevant certificates are supplied; the importer's broker handles the declaration.
